Outside the Coliseum, in [[Olympus Coliseum]], is a good place to gain experience points. Walk towards the other end of the entrance and one [[Air Soldier]], one [[Invisible]], and two [[Wizard]]s will spawn. After defeating them, more will appear. By defeating the multiple swarms of enemies, the player will gain around 8000 to 9000 experience points. The best place to gain experience toward the end of the game is in [[Castle Oblivion]]. | The best place to gain experience toward the end of the game is in [[Castle Oblivion]]. Equip the [[Zero/One]] for it's clock abilities [[Attack Upgrade]], [[All Critical]], [[Heavy Blade]], and [[Targeting Scope]]. You'll also want to attach [[Mega Flare]] as the Finish command, and equip a few [[Magnega]]. Run around breaking the Blox to build up your Clock Gauge then talk to [[Hercules]]. You'll face off against endless waves of [[Shadow]] for 30 seconds, by just attacking you should be able to one-shot all of them and use Mega Flare to wipe out the rest. After your Clock Gauge resets, use your Magnega and other commands to build up your gauge and keep the cycle going. You should be able to easily defeat 50 with this method. You'll have to face a [[Large Body]] and a few Wizards after this fight which are made easy with Heavy Blade, and All Critical. After that you'll encounter a few Shadowz and have to find the right one. You can speed this up by using either a Magnega or Mega Flare. Finally you'll face off against [[Angel Star]], Wizards, and Invisible which again can be defeated easily with Magnega and Mega Flare. By doing this you can earn over 50,000 experience in under a minute. | ||
